In this episode of Psyched for Sanity, Dr. Parker and Dr. Doss explore #TherapistSelfDisclosure and how clinicians decide what to share, when to share it, and why. They discuss the clinical purpose of self-disclosure, the potential benefits and risks, and how boundaries and context shape what is appropriate in different therapeutic settings.
